While Millfield school had seen the end of the school day, the Goodgymmers crept in to continue the work we started in the summer holidays, creating a woodland area for the children to learn about nature and have fun. We were greeted with a mound of woodchip right next to the start of the woodland trail.

The team were straight to work filling the wheel barrows with woodchip and laying the woodland trail path, Mel did great job flattening the path with her sweeping brush. Meanwhile Tommo was placing bird boxes he had made in secret locations for the school children to try and spot them through the trail, there's 4 to search for.

Lindsay did an amazing job cutting back more branches, some with berries that we thought could be a risk with kids. We also litter-picked a bag and Nick played curling with Ashley, she swept as he wheel borrowed more woodchip making him go faster, teamwork!

Before we knew it the day was drawing in on us, 3 quarters of the way through the mound, it was home time. Weldone team fantastic efforts all round, deffinatly some strength work ticked off this evening.
